I know fathers are supposed to let go of sons, mothers of daughters, but I also know that it rarely happens that way. Parents cling to their children beyond all enduring, as if they have an absolute right to control their lives from the day they’re born. And so the onus passes from generation to generation until a child appears with the innate power to break the bind. That is the way of all flesh.
